The Art of Selecting Your Square Sectional
Factors to Consider When Choosing Your Sectional
Selecting the right square sectional involves several key factors. First, measure your space carefully to ensure a good fit. Consider the room's layout and traffic flow when deciding on size and configuration. Think about your lifestyle and how you'll use the sectional. Do you need a sleeper sofa option for guests? How many people do you usually seat? Comfort is crucial, so test out different models if possible. Look for features that match your needs, like reclining seats or built-in storage. Don't forget to consider the maintenance requirements of different materials.
The Role of Material and Texture in Comfort and Style
The material of your square sectional greatly impacts both comfort and style. Leather offers a luxurious feel and easy cleaning, but may not suit all climates. Fabric upholstery comes in various textures and colors, allowing for more personalization. Microfiber is durable and stain-resistant, ideal for families with kids or pets. Velvet adds a touch of elegance but requires more care. Consider the texture's feel against your skin for maximum comfort. The material also affects the couch's longevity and maintenance needs. Choose a material that balances your style preferences with practical considerations.
Navigating the Warranty and Quality in Sectional Couches
When investing in a square sectional, understanding warranty and quality is crucial. Look for brands known for durability and good customer service. Read the warranty terms carefully, noting what's covered and for how long. Quality indicators include solid frame construction and high-density foam cushions. Check the stitching and fabric quality, especially in high-wear areas. Some companies offer extended warranties for an additional cost. This can be worth it for expensive or heavily used sectionals. Don't hesitate to ask questions about the manufacturing process and materials used.
